Displays the current state of the heating or cooling system. If a state change
is made while viewing this page, click Refresh to update the status.
Heat – First stage heat is actively heating.
Heat2 – First stage and second stage heat are actively heating. (Fuel
Burner)
Aux Ht – First stage and auxiliary heat are actively heating. (Heat
Pump)
Cool – First stage cool is actively cooling.
Cool2 – First stage and second stage A/C are actively cooling.
Off – Neither the heating system or cooling system is active (i.e. on).
